Flying Brick Cider
The VisitVineyards.com team has taste-tested the three naturally brewed ciders from Flying Brick – the Original, Pear and Draught – and can highly recommend these refreshing beverages, each delicious in its own style.
And we're not the only ones who like them with the awarding of a Bronze Medal at the Royal Melbourne Fine Food Awards to each earlier this year.
The ciders are naturally brewed using traditional methods and crafted from 100% crispy apples and succulent Packham pears, sourced from Victorian orchards. They're also free from added sugars, colours and concentrates.

The Australian Cider Guide
As Max Allen says in his introduction, 'Australia is in the middle of a cider boom. Cider is everywhere. We can't get enough of the stuff...A boom can be exhilarating but it can also be daunting.'
Having so many to choose from and with new brands continually popping up, trying to find the ciders that suit your particular taste can almost put you off the whole idea – which would be boring! So The Australian Cider Guide is here, extending a helping hand to tempt you into discovering just why this explosion is happening.
It has some crucial background details on the history around the world and here in Australia, the importance of the right fruit, enjoying cider with/without food and sections on the different styles. With this information on board, you're now ready to start your tour (on paper for now) of many of Australia's cider brands through the following pages.
